If you, or anyone else, feels it should not be added to the stable tree, please let <stable@vger.kernel.org> know about it. >From ae5943de8c8c4438cbac5cda599ff0b88c224468 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Malcolm Priestley <tvbox...@gmail.com> Date: Wed, 30 Jan 2013 20:07:29 +0000 Subject: staging: vt6656: Fix URB submitted while active warning. From: Malcolm Priestley <tvbox...@gmail.com> commit ae5943de8c8c4438cbac5cda599ff0b88c224468 upstream. This error happens because PIPEnsControlOut and PIPEnsControlIn unlock the spin lock for delay, letting in another thread. The patch moves the current MP_SET_FLAG to before filling of sUsbCtlRequest for pControlURB and clears it in event of failing. Any thread calling either function while fMP_CONTROL_READS or fMP_CONTROL_WRITES flags set will return STATUS_FAILURE.
